Hey fellas,

So my 08 Z was getting a p0011 and it’s at about 118k miles so I decided to do the gallery gaskets.

I just took off the timing cover, and I marked on the crankshaft where the line is on the oil pump to match the crankshaft with for TDC. However once I aligned it, I noticed that both of my cam sprockets were just slightly off from the circle on the backplate that they are supposed to line up with. And if I line up the cam sprockets correctly, the crankshaft ends up being a tooth off of the mark, but it’s still up and to the left.

I’m wondering what I should do to make sure I get this thing to TDC before I put it back together? Should I line up the crankshaft and then take off the primary chain, get a chain clamp and spin the sprockets clockwise until they’re lined up? They are only slightly off.

Only reason why I’m skeptical about this is because when I was taking out the crankshaft bolt, I spun the motor counterclockwise with my breaker bar probably only 20-30 degrees total. But I heard either one or two faint clicking sounds which makes me thing I might’ve misaligned the chain? would I have misaligned the primary or cam chain?

A bit of a noob here but I would appreciate the help! Gonna upload pictures here in a sec.


Left side cam sprocket needs to go a tooth clockwise

And right side cam sprocket needs to go a tooth clockwise too

Crank looks to be on point yeah?
